THE BEST SIDE OF NET33 RTP

The best Side of Net33 RTP

The best Side of Net33 RTP

Blog Article

Notice that the amount of visitors despatched in the multicast tree would not change as the quantity of receivers boosts, While the level of RTCP traffic grows linearly with the amount of receivers. To unravel this scaling trouble, RTCP modifies the speed at which a participant sends RTCP packets into your multicast tree as a operate of the amount of contributors during the session.

RFC 3550 RTP July 2003 to offer the data required by a particular software and will frequently be integrated into the application processing instead of getting executed being a independent layer. RTP is really a protocol framework which is intentionally not comprehensive. This document specifies These capabilities predicted to be common throughout each of the programs for which RTP could well be proper. As opposed to traditional protocols in which supplemental functions may be accommodated by earning the protocol a lot more basic or by incorporating a possibility system that will need parsing, RTP is intended being tailor-made via modifications and/or additions into the headers as required. Illustrations are offered in Sections 5.three and six.four.three. Therefore, Together with this document, a complete specification of RTP for a particular application will require a number of companion files (see Section thirteen): o a profile specification doc, which defines a list of payload sort codes and their mapping to payload formats (e.g., media encodings). A profile could also outline extensions or modifications to RTP that happen to be certain to a certain course of programs.

Software writers ought to be aware that private community tackle assignments such as the Net-ten assignment proposed in RFC 1918 [24] could create network addresses that are not globally one of a kind. This would produce non-unique CNAMEs if hosts with personal addresses and no direct IP connectivity to the general public Online have their RTP packets forwarded to the general public Internet through an RTP-degree translator. (See also RFC 1627 [

RTP multicast streams belonging with each other, which include audio and online video streams emanating from several senders within a videoconference software, belong to an RTP session.

There exists an unfamiliar relationship situation in between Cloudflare and also the origin World wide web server. Therefore, the Web content can't be shown.

RFC 3550 RTP July 2003 its timestamp into the wallclock time when that video body was introduced to your narrator. The sampling instant for that audio RTP packets containing the narrator's speech will be founded by referencing the exact same wallclock time in the event the audio was sampled. The audio and online video may even be transmitted by diverse hosts In case the reference clocks on The 2 hosts are synchronized by some implies for example NTP. A receiver can then synchronize presentation in the audio and video clip packets by relating their RTP timestamps using the timestamp pairs in RTCP SR packets. SSRC: 32 bits The SSRC area identifies the synchronization resource. This identifier SHOULD be chosen randomly, While using the intent that no two synchronization resources in the very same RTP session can have the identical SSRC identifier. An case in point algorithm for building a random identifier is presented in Appendix A.6. Although the likelihood of a number of resources deciding on the very same identifier is minimal, all RTP implementations should be prepared to detect and solve collisions. Segment 8 describes the likelihood of collision along with a mechanism for resolving collisions and detecting RTP-degree forwarding loops dependant on the uniqueness of your SSRC identifier.

This algorithm implements a straightforward again-off mechanism which brings about end users to hold back RTCP packet transmission In case the team dimensions are growing. o When users depart a session, both by using a BYE or by timeout, the team membership decreases, and thus the calculated interval ought to lower. A "reverse reconsideration" algorithm is utilised to permit users to extra rapidly reduce their intervals in reaction to group membership decreases. o BYE packets are specified various therapy than other RTCP packets. Every time a person leaves a bunch, and desires to send out a BYE packet, it may well accomplish that in advance of its future scheduled RTCP packet. On the other hand, transmission of BYEs follows a again-off algorithm which avoids floods of BYE packets should a lot of customers concurrently depart the session. This algorithm can be used for sessions wherein all individuals are allowed to deliver. In that scenario, the session bandwidth parameter could be the product or service of the individual sender's bandwidth instances the quantity of individuals, as well as the RTCP bandwidth is five% of that. Facts with the algorithm's operation are given during the sections that abide by. Appendix A.seven gives an case in point implementation. Schulzrinne, et al. Benchmarks Track [Page 27]

You might not have the capacity to build an account or ask for plasmids through this Web site right until you enhance your browser. Learn more Remember to Notice: Your browser doesn't thoroughly guidance several of the characteristics utilized on Addgene's Site. Should you operate into any challenges registering, depositing, or purchasing you should Speak to us at [email protected]. Learn more Look for Search

ENTERBRAIN grants to Licensee a non-exceptional, non-assignable, rate-totally free license to utilize the RTP SOFTWARE only for the reason to play the sport created and distributed by RPG MAKER XP people who shall entire the registration procedure.

Want help? Ship us an e-mail at [e mail shielded] Privateness Plan Skip to main written content This Web site employs cookies to make sure you get the best encounter. By continuing to make use of This web site, you comply with the usage of cookies. Remember to Observe: Your browser would not guidance the features utilized on Addgene's Web site.

The SSRC isn't the IP deal with from the sender, but alternatively a variety that the resource assigns randomly in the event the new stream is commenced. The probability that two streams get assigned exactly the same SSRC may be very modest.

Accompanying the RTP media channels, there is one RTCP media Management channel. Every one of the RTP and RTCP channels run above UDP. In addition to the RTP/RTCP channels, two other channels are required, the call Command channel and the call signaling channel. The H.245 get in touch with Command channel is really a TCP relationship that carries H.245 Management messages.

RFC 3550 RTP July 2003 The Management targeted visitors need to be restricted to a small and recognised portion on the session bandwidth: tiny to ensure that the primary functionality of the transportation protocol to carry information just isn't impaired; recognized so that the Command traffic is usually included in the bandwidth specification given to some useful resource reservation protocol, and so that each participant can independently calculate its share. The Manage traffic bandwidth is Besides the session bandwidth for the information website traffic. It is RECOMMENDED which the fraction from the session bandwidth included for RTCP be mounted at five%. It is usually Advisable that one/4 on the RTCP bandwidth be dedicated to members which are sending data making sure that in sessions with a lot of receivers but a small range of senders, newly becoming a member of individuals will extra speedily acquire the CNAME for your sending sites. If the proportion of senders is bigger than 1/four of the individuals, the senders get their proportion of the entire RTCP bandwidth. Even though the values of such and also other constants during the interval calculation are certainly not crucial, all individuals from the session Have to use a similar values so exactly the same interval is going to be calculated. As a result, these constants Really should be preset for a specific profile. A profile May possibly specify which the Manage site visitors bandwidth may be a independent parameter in the session in lieu of a rigid proportion on the session bandwidth. Using a individual parameter enables rate- adaptive apps to set an RTCP bandwidth in keeping with a "typical" knowledge bandwidth which is decreased than the utmost bandwidth specified because of the session bandwidth parameter.

Therefore, packets that get there late are usually not counted as missing, and the decline could possibly be damaging if you will discover duplicates. The amount of packets expected is described to get the prolonged previous sequence quantity received, as defined future, a lot less the Preliminary sequence selection received. This can be calculated as proven in Appendix A.three. prolonged greatest sequence number been given: 32 bits The lower sixteen bits contain the best sequence quantity received within an RTP information packet from resource SSRC_n, and also the most important sixteen bits lengthen that sequence range Together with the corresponding rely of sequence number cycles, which can be managed in accordance with the algorithm in Appendix A.1. Observe that various receivers in the Net33 Info RTP very same session will generate diverse extensions to the sequence amount if their begin situations differ drastically. interarrival jitter: 32 bits An estimate in the statistical variance of your RTP information packet interarrival time, measured in timestamp models and expressed as an unsigned integer. The interarrival jitter J is outlined to generally be the imply deviation (smoothed complete value) of the main difference D in packet spacing at the receiver when compared with the sender for any set of packets. As demonstrated during the equation beneath, this is similar to the real difference during the "relative transit time" for the two packets; Schulzrinne, et al. Criteria Keep track of [Web site 39]

Report this page